cutecom: A serial terminal program with a Qt GUI1

CuteCom is a graphical serial terminal like minicom, but offering an easy-to-use GUI. It is aimed mainly at hardware developers or other people who need a terminal to talk to their devices. It is heavily inspired by Bray++ for Windows.
